Abstract
New Np(V) selenate complexes with various outer-sphere cations, K[(NpO2)(SeO4)(H2O)] (1), Rb[(NpO2)(SeO4)(H2O)] (2), and Cs[(NpO2)(SeO4)(H2O)] (3), were synthesized and studied by single-crystal X-ray diffraction. The compounds are isostructural; the Np(V) coordination polyhedron is a pentagonal bipyramid. Neptunyl(V) ions NpO2+ are combined in zigzag chains by cation-cation interaction.
